4 houses gutted in Kangan

SHEIKH NAZIR

Kangan, Apr 12: Four houses were gutted in Oshker and Rayil villages in Kangan Tehsil of district Ganderbal on Monday.
 The houses of Shabir Ahmad Raina son of Nazir Ahmad Raina, Muhammad Yousuf Sheikh son of Muhammad Abdullah Sheikh and Fayaz Ahmad son of Sanaullah were gutted in a blaze at Rayil village.
 In another incident the house of Nika Muhammad Tedwa son of Gulla Tedwa was gutted in a blaze at Poshker village.
 The cause of the fire in both places could not be ascertained, police said.
